As it is known, the simplest and most convenient method of testing traction motors operating in open-pit mining is the method based on determining the motor heating by the RMS (effective) current. Knowledge of the effective current of electric locomotives is also necessary for a number of calculations related to the electrification of quarry railway transportation: to determine the energy losses in the electric circuit of the electric locomotive, energy losses in the contact network, etc.
The work of quarry railway transport is characterized firstly by a closed, continuously repeating cyclicity, secondly, a relatively stable number of trains engaged in the transportation of minerals and waste rock for a very long time, thirdly, a limited number of types of electric locomotives and, consequently, and types of trains by weight ...
